如何将金山卫士的皮肤用于游戏场景布局设计
下午三点半的阳光斜照在电脑屏幕上,我正嚼着薄荷糖研究金山卫士的皮肤文件。这个陪伴我八年的安全软件,它的界面设计里藏着不少能用在游戏场景布局里的宝藏。就像把老屋子的雕花窗框拆下来装到新房子里,既保留韵味又增添新意。
一、皮肤文件拆解基础课
用压缩软件打开金山卫士的.skin格式文件时,会看到这些核心组件:
- 颜色配置文件(color.ini)
- 界面元素坐标表(position.xml)
- 九宫格切图素材包(images文件夹)
- 动态效果脚本(animation.lua)
组件类型 | 游戏适配场景 | 适配难度 |
颜色配置 | HUD界面配色 | ★☆☆☆☆ |
坐标参数 | UI元素定位 | ★★★☆☆ |
切图素材 | 按钮/边框设计 | ★★★★☆ |
1.1 颜色迁移实战
打开color.ini会看到类似MainBG=3A5F89的色值定义。这些经过专业验证的色彩组合,特别适合用在需要长时间注视的游戏状态栏。比如策略类游戏的资源面板,直接套用主界面背景色+辅助色的组合,能降低玩家视觉疲劳。
二、动态效果改造技巧
金山卫士的进度条展开动画,经过参数调整就能变成RPG游戏的技能冷却效果。把原脚本里的animation_duration=300改成800,圆弧展开速度刚好匹配魔法吟唱时长。
- 原版弹窗抖动动画 → 游戏成就解锁特效
- 病毒扫描进度环 → 角色经验值累积动效
- 内存清理波纹 → 水下关卡环境特效
2.1 坐标参数转换公式
当需要把皮肤元素移植到1080P游戏界面时,记住这个换算口诀:原X轴值×1.5,Y轴减10%做缓冲。比如原关闭按钮定位(920,15),转换后应设为(1380,13),这个算法在《界面设计适配手册》里有详细论证。
分辨率 | 缩放系数 | 坐标修正值 |
1280×720 | 1.0 | ±0 |
1920×1080 | 1.5 | Y-10% |
三、实战案例:塔防游戏界面改造
上周用金山卫士的科技蓝皮肤帮朋友改了个塔防游戏的商店界面。把原皮肤的模块化按钮直接移植过来,省去了80%的美术工作量。秘诀在于保留按钮的边框发光特性,但把图标换成炮塔造型。
特别要注意的是音效触发机制。原皮肤的hover.wav提示音调高两个音阶后,完美匹配点击防御建筑的反馈声。这个技巧在《游戏音频设计原理》中有二十页的专门论述。
3.1 字体渲染注意事项
金山卫士默认的微软雅黑字体在游戏场景会出现边缘虚化问题。推荐改用思源黑体并开启次像素渲染,这样在小尺寸文字显示时,血量数值的辨识度能提升40%以上。
窗外的天色渐渐暗下来,咖啡杯底残留着冷却的痕迹。保存好刚调试完的布局文件,突然发现游戏开始界面和金山卫士的皮肤设置页竟有种奇妙的神似——那些精心设计的人机交互逻辑,原来早就在我们熟悉的软件里埋下线索。
网友留言(0)